In the Name of Allah, the Merciful, the Most Merciful
Alif Lam Mim. 1 These are the verses of the sagacious Book, 2 Guidance and mercy for the righteous. 3 Those who establish regular Prayer, and give regular Charity, and have (in their hearts) the assurance of the Hereafter. 4 They follow the guidance of their Lord and they will have everlasting happiness. 5 There are some people who would purchase distracting talk, to lead astray from the Path of Allah without knowledge, and take it in mockery; for those is a humiliating punishment. 6 And when Our revelations are recited unto him he turneth away in pride as if he heard them not, as if there were a deafness in his ears. So give him tidings of a painful doom. 7 For those who believe and work righteous deeds, there will be Gardens of Bliss,- 8 where they shall live for ever. The promise of Allah is the truth; He is the Almighty, the Wise. 9 He created the heavens without any supports visible to you, and cast mountains as anchors into the earth so that it may not shake with you, and spread all kinds of beasts in it; and We sent down water from the sky so thereby grew all kinds of refined pairs in it. 10 Such is the creation of Allah; now show me what, other than Him, created! No, the harmdoers are in clear error. 11
